APEC Chile 2019 would have been an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ation (APEC) series of meetings in Chile. The meetings were supposed to take place in Santiago and focus on the digital economy, regional connectivity, and women’s role in economic growth. … The 2019 summit was cancelled on 30 October due to ongoing protests.

What is the disadvantage of APEC?

APEC’s problems stem from three principal weaknesses: a lack of consensus among members over its objectives and how these might best be realized; the absence of a body that has the capacity to be a dynamo for the grouping; and a failure to engage with civil society.

Is APEC still a thing?

APEC has grown to become a dynamic engine of economic growth and one of the most important regional forums in the Asia-Pacific. Its 21 member economies are home to around 2.9 billion people and represent approximately 60 percent of world GDP and 48 percent of world trade in 2018.

Why was APEC created?

APEC was formed to encourage a growing and prosperous regional economy through: trade and investment liberalisation and facilitation – at the border, across the border and behind the border. reduced costs of cross-border trade to assist businesses. economic and technical cooperation.

What is APEC's purpose?

APEC’s principal goal is to ensure that goods, services, capital, and labor can move easily across borders. This includes increasing custom efficiency at borders, encouraging favorable business climates within member economies, and harmonizing regulations and policies across the region.

Why is India not part of APEC?

India’s entry into Apec has been blocked due to different reasons, namely its unfair treatment of foreign direct investments in the country and its perceived inability to carry out steady economic reforms. India in Apec can be beneficial for all members in terms of market access.

How APEC affect Philippines?

APEC economies account for 84 percent of the total trade of the Philippines worldwide. … Total imports from APEC economies make up 85 percent of total imports from our trading partners. About 64 percent of foreign direct investment (FDI) into the Philippines come from APEC.
